Output 80d900ef23a604c76b6eeaf96651e1cfb046398440517b38d9e2e9a770757271:0

value
5173719
script pubkey
OP_0 OP_PUSHBYTES_20 6b7eca33e0bc2580bd3c3a6080fbeb4c45c83dbc
address
bc1qddlv5vlqhsjcp0fu8fsgp7ltf3zus0duglq0nu
transaction
80d900ef23a604c76b6eeaf96651e1cfb046398440517b38d9e2e9a770757271